Plumbing issues follow the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Road, original cast iron can be rough within, like sandpaper to oil and lint. Those pipelines were implied for a different age of soaps and water usage. In time, interior scaling tightens the size, and every bit of congealed fat or coffee ground has more areas to capture. Farther west toward Seminary Road and Beauregard, post-war homes often have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have actually lived past their convenience zone. Clay sections shift at joints and welcome hairline origin invasion. The roots thrive where yard watering and foundation growings keep the soil damp.
On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ees vast swings between saturating tornados and dry spells. After hefty rainfall, sump storm drain cleaning pumps push more water toward major lines, and any weak point in a drain ends up being noticeable. During cold snaps, oil in cooking area runs comes to be a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ow streets and shared easements make complex access. A professional drain cleaning company that functions here on a regular basis learns to stage equipment with very little foot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out accessibility, and plan for the old-house peculiarities that do not show up in a textbook.

After the walk-through, the work separates right into gain access to, diagnosis, and elimination. Gain access to depends upon the component and where the clog is, yet cleanouts are the best starting factor. If a residential or commercial property does not have usable cleanouts, it may require drawing a toilet or getting rid of a trap. For diagnosis, experts rely on two devices as a standard: a cable machine and a cam. The cable figures out whether the line is openable. The cam shows why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.
Cable job has its very own finesse. On a kitchen line, cord selection matters due to the fact that soft cables pierce via gr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scratching a tidy path. A stiffer cable with an effectively sized blade has a tendency to reduce as opposed to poke holes, which means the line remains clear longer. In cast iron, oscillating and incremental onward pressure stays clear of gouging a currently slim wall. In clay laterals with origins, you do not wish to ram the cable so hard that it broadens a joint. The goal is managed reducing, not brute force.
Once flow is brought back, the camera levels. I have discovered offsets that just obstruct when a cleaning device discharges at complete rate, and stubborn bellies that hold just adequate water to trap paper for weeks. Without a video camera, you might think the clog is arbitrary and support for the following one. With video clip, you understand whether you require a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or just much better habits.
Clogged drains pipes are not a solitary classification. Hair in a tub waste requires a different touch than dust sn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air obstructions respond to manual removal and a brief cable television run. If the tub has an old trip-lever assembly with a corroded spring, that system might be the real issue, capturing hair like a rake. Changing the setting up while the line is open protects against the repeat call.
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ern recipe soaps reduced grease much better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ipe w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me products have their area for upkeep, but they can not dig deep into solidified fats that have cooled and layered. On a grease line, a two-step technique functions best: mechanical cutting to restore flow, then a controlled warm water flush to rinse suspended fats downstream. If the grease extends into the major, or if the buildup is heavy and layered, hydro jetting becomes a smarter selection than duplicated cabling.
Toilets provide their own problems. A solitary clog after an inexpedient flush of wipes is one point. Repeated blockages indicate a catch design probl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the wardrobe bend. I have discovered pl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the property owner, that only created issues when paper stuck behind them. An electronic camera with a little head can slip past the commode flange after pulling the fixture, which five-minute look can conserve you changing a whole bathroom that is blameless.
Basement flooring drains and laundry standpipes commonly misdirect. When both backup, lots of people think the major sewage system is blocked. Often that holds true. Various other times a check valve has actually fail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that disposes a rise. A serious drain cleaning company tests components one by one, views flows,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ures yet burps throughout a washer cycle, ability, not outright clog, is your villain.
Hydro jetting utilizes high-pressure water, commonly in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, delivered with a hose with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and combs the pipe wall, and the back jets pull the pipe ahead while flushing debris back to the cleanout. For hefty oil and split range, it is a lot more efficient than cabling due to the fact that it cleans the complete circ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line extra uniformly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to catch paper.
Jetting brings its own policies. Pipeline condition dictates stress and nozzle option. In breakable cast iron with obvious thinning, use lower pressure and a rotating nozzle that brightens instead of blades. In more recent P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or comparable nozzle gets rid of sludge quickly without risk. A knowledgeable technology determines how swiftly the line is removing by the feeling of the hose, the noise of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or aggregate puts out, you might be handling a broken pipeline or a flattened section, and every min of jetting should be stabilized versus the threat of washing a lot more bed linens away.
The finest use case for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the major drainpipe with scale and paper hang-ups, and industrial lines that see consistent food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Opportunity know the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ps service nonstop. For a homeowner with repeating kitchen area sink backups every three months, a single jetting often resets the clock for a year or even more, gave the line is sound and the household stays clear of dumping oil down the drain.
Sewer cleaning is about bring back circulation, yet that does not imply giving up the backyard or the walkway. Alexandria's narrow lots usually hide the sewage system lateral under garden beds and rock sidewalks.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service stages pipes and machines to safeguard plantings and stays clear of unneeded excavation. Begin with every available cleanout. If the residential property lacks one near the front, it might deserve mounting a new cleanout at the residential or commercial property line. That solitary improvement can transform a half-day battle into a one-hour upkeep job.
Cabling a video pipe inspection drain needs to be a measured process. If roots are present, a collection of gradually larger blades is much better than leaping to the maximum dimension and eating the joint right into an uneven birthed. Electronic camera assessment after the initial pass tells you where the origins are getting in. Lots of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from the house to the pathway, then a PVC replacement to the city main. The change is where origins get into. When you understand the precise location, you can cut easily and review whether an area repair, lining,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.
Grease in a sewer is much less typical for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and residential properties with cellar kitchen areas see it more. Jetting excels below, with a last pass of warm water to bring the slurry downstream. If numerous units contribute to the line, the schedule matters as long as the approach. Coordinating a building-wide kitchen area time out during the solution avoids fresh discharge from moving grease right into a recently cleaned segment.
Not every problem justifies prompt replacement. I lug a set of examples in my head from work where patience and upkeep worked better than a rush to dig. A house ow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a solitary joint, six feet from the visual. We reduced them clean, jetted the line, and saw a mild countered on video camera without much soil noticeable. As opposed to trench a rock pathway and interfere with the well-known boxwoods, we set up orig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dose of root control foam after the springtime development flush. That was 8 years back. The walkway is undamaged, and overall upkeep prices still rest below the rate of excavation by a wide margin.
On the various other hand, I have seen bellies that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Cam footage reveals paper being in the dip, moving only with hefty circulations. In those situations, no amount of jetting changes the geometry. You can keep around a stubborn belly, however you will cope with periodic downturns and more stringent policies about what decreases. If the stomach s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, collaborate the repair work with the paving. You just want to dig deep into once.

Some practices bring more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the villains they are constructed out to be, yet they can be abused. Coffee premises are fine in percentages if purged with great deals of water, however they come to be mortar when mixed with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es labeled "flushable" spread gradually and entangle in harsh pipe wall surfaces. Soap scum in older bathtubs is a lot more regarding water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and regular enzyme upkeep assistance keep those lines honest.
A well-timed hot water flush after greasy food preparation evenings makes a distinction. Run the tap on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old grease, however it pushes soft residues out of the catch arm and right into larger size pipeline where they are less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ons prevents a rise that bewilders marginal standpipes. If your camera revealed a tummy, that spacing is not optional.
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air work as the restoration. Cabling is exact for hard obstructions, roots, and localized ob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, oil, sludge, and scale. Repair service or lining solves geometry troubles, broken sectors, and major intrusions.
If your main has a single root invasion at a joint and the pipeline is otherwise strong,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ting offers you clean wall surfaces and a longer interval in between sees. If your kitchen area line is slow-moving each month and the video camera shows heavy grease from end to end, jetting is worth the investment. If the video camera shows a collapse, a deep belly, or a major countered, skip duplicated cleaning and price the repair work. On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Road, 3 next-door neighbors called within two months with the exact same issue: sluggish first-floor bathrooms, gurgling bathtub drains, and occasional cellar floor drain wetness after tornados. The common element was a clay segment right before the city major, gotten into by roots. Each home had a different layout, but the electronic camera informed the very same tale. The initial house owner selected semiannual origin cutting. The second chose hydro jetting plus a foam origin treatment. The 3rd set up a place repair service prior to an intended patio improvement. local licensed plumber A year later, all three continued to be happy, each with a remedy matched to their budget plan and tolerance for repeating maintenance.
In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a family members dealt with a cooking area line that clogged every 6 weeks. The run took a trip with a completed ceiling and turned two times previously dropping to the major. Cable television passes opened circulation, but oil retur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a little rotating nozzle at moderate pressure, after that purged with hot water and degreaser. The electronic camera revealed a tidy, bright interior. We moved the air admission shutoff to boost airing vent, which decreased the sink's slowness. With nothing else altered, they went eighteen months prior to the following service phone call, and that one was for a washroom sink catch, not the kitchen.

If a solitary component is sluggish, clear the catch and check the air vent. Sometimes a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a flat roofing system vent develops negative stress that simulates a blockage. For a stubborn kitchen area sink that is still draining pipes gradually, a long, stable warm water run can press soft grease past a sticky section. Avoid putting chemicals into the drain. They can burn a tech during solution, and they hardly ever touch the real blockage. If numerous components at the lowest level are supporting, quit using water and require s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water threats flooding and damage, and any type of additional disc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Plumbers mechanically break up or flush out the blockage using professional equipment. Snaking cuts through debris, while hydro jetting uses high-pressure water to clean pipe walls. Camera inspections help confirm the clog is fully cleared. The approach depends on severity and drain type.
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led โflushable,โ because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.
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
